What is the climate of the Peloponnese?
Aside from the very center of the peninsula, which is continental, the climate is categorized as hot Mediterranean, though proximity to the coast and especially elevation serve to mitigate the heat.

True or false the wines of Mavrodaphne of Patras are always fortified
True.
The wines are always fortified, but this can occur at different times. Top producers will add spirits to arrest an already in-process fermentation (the same method used to produce a French vin doux naturel), while more production-oriented wineries will simply blend spirit and unfermented must (akin to mistelle or vin de liqueur).

Describe the wine style of Monemvasia Malvasia
The grapes must be dried, though fortification is optional. The wine is then aged in barrel at least two years prior to release and can be bottled as either a single vintage or a blend of vintages
